    Imagine if you will, an island made of cornbread. And on that island of cornbread, grows a forest…read moreof lush turnip greens. Swarms of pink katydids made of ham, flutter across the lush turnip greens landscape. Surrounding the cornbread island, is a sea. In that sea, pink dolphins made of ham frolic, while schools of black-eyed peas swim in flowing unison. The devils of mayhem; diced onions and sliced jalapenos patiently wait and watch over the serene harmony, prepared to bring turmoil at the first opportunity. That was a satirical description of a meal called the "Soul Bowl." It can be found on Eunice's menu under Local Favorites. Bless her heart for coming up with this concoction! If you know what I mean. A filling bowl of food. My wife regretted it. Check the picture. Meanwhile back at the ranch....I played it safe, with an order of chicken fried chicken and mashed potatoes, all covered with cream gravy. For my side I had a lightly seasoned cucumber salad. This was a very good meal. The name Eunice's Country Cookin' describes the diner well. A menu of American diner food staples, daily specials and those delicious home-made pies. Inside, tables and uncomfortable metal chairs are scattered across the large open dining area. Seat yourself. Someone will be with you quickly. Great friendly service. Well established and loved; the restaurant and most of its customers have been around for a long time.
